Johnson Controls International PLC vs Vanguard Information Technology Index Fund ETF — how do they compare? Johnson Controls International PLC trades at $155.05 (market cap $93.74B), while Vanguard Information Technology Index Fund ETF trades at $121.41. The key difference: Johnson Controls International PLC pays a 1.03% dividend while Vanguard Information Technology Index Fund ETF pays none, and Johnson Controls International PLC is trading nearer its 52-week high, Vanguard Information Technology Index Fund ETF nearer its low. Johnson Controls International PLC

JCI trades at $153.59, up 1.92% on the day, with a bullish technical outlook and strong institutional support. Recent Q3 2026 earnings beat expectations with $1.42 EPS versus $1.30 expected, driven by double-digit organic growth in data-center thermal systems. The company raised FY26 guidance, reflecting robust demand and operational momentum. Valuation ratios remain elevated, with a P/E of 43.59 and P/S of 3.82, indicating premium pricing relative to historical norms.

The outlook is positive, supported by earnings momentum and AI-driven demand for cooling solutions, but risks include high valuation sensitivity and debt levels. Analyst consensus price target is $168.25, suggesting ~9.5% upside, with no sell ratings among 45 analysts. Investors should monitor execution on guidance and macroeconomic impacts on construction and HVAC markets.

About Johnson Controls International PLC

Johnson Controls manufactures, installs, and services HVAC systems, building management systems and controls, industrial refrigeration systems, and fire and security solutions. Commercial HVAC accounts for about 40% of sales, fire and security also represents 40% of sales, and residential HVAC, industrial refrigeration, and other solutions account for the remaining 20% of revenue. In fiscal 2021, Johnson Controls generated over $23.5 billion in revenue.

About Vanguard Information Technology Index Fund ETF

The fund employs an indexing investment approach designed to track the performance of the MSCI US Investable Market Index/Information Technology 25/50, an index made up of stocks of large, mid-size, and small US companies within the information technology sector, as classified under the GICS. The advisor attempts to replicate the target index by seeking to invest all of its assets in the stocks that make up the index, in order to hold each stock in approximately the same proportion as its weighting in the index. It is non-diversified.
